[TOC]
## 数据库视图管理工具
开发时,我们的应用使用的是 Homestead 虚拟机里的 MySQL 数据库。为了方便调试和查看数据,我们需要在主机中安装 MySQL 数据库视图工具,然后连接到 虚拟机里的 MySQL 数据库服务器。
无论你是使用哪种 MySQL 数据库查看工具,打开您使用的工具软件按以下 Homestead 虚拟机里的 MySQL 数据库服务器连接参数,在软件里添加数据库连接。
- Host: 127.0.0.1
- Port: 33060
- User: homestead
- Pass: secret
>[warning] 此处使用了 VirtualBox 虚拟机的『端口转发』功能,Homestead 脚本默认将本机端口 33060 转发到虚拟机里的 3306 端口。所以,只要我们连接本机的 33060 端口,即可读取虚拟机中的 MySQL 数据库。(3306 是默认的 MySQL 端口)
接下来详细讲下 Mac 和 Win 平台下的 MySQL 数据库查看工具的安装。**如果你的电脑上已经有 MySQL 数据库查看工具,可以不必安装下面介绍的管理工具,但请参照下面截图完成 Homestead 数据库的连接。**
## 1. Mac OS
在 Mac 上,我们可以通过安装 [SequelPro](http://www.sequelpro.com/) ( [百度盘下载](https://pan.baidu.com/s/1slWENqH#list/path=%2F) )来进行数据库的一些操作,如查阅数据或删除数据。SequelPro 是一款开源的数据库软件,非常容易使用。
打开 SequelPro 并进行如下的设置,Password 一栏需要填写 Homestead 的默认数据库密码:secret。
![Mac SequelPro](http://tbs.zhanghong.info/images/chapters/02/080_gui_mac.png)
接着,点击 `Test connection` 测试连接。测试通过后点击 `Add to Favorites` 收藏此设置。最后,点击 `Connect` 按钮即可连接到 `Homestead` 数据库。
## 2. Windows
如果你是使用 Windows 机器进行开发,推荐使用 [HeidiSQL](https://www.heidisql.com/) ( [百度盘下载](https://pan.baidu.com/s/1jH6o5sa#list/path=%2F) )。连接信息从上面读取。
![Windows HeidiSQL](http://tbs.zhanghong.info/images/chapters/02/080_gui_win.png)
## 查看数据库
我们使用连接工具打开 Homestead 上的数据库,可以看到其中有一个叫 `think_bbs` 的数据库。这是因为我们在 [创建项目](../c2_stage/02040_创建项目.md) 这一步里配置了一个 名字叫 `think_bbs` 的数据库,Homestead 在重新加载配置时自动为我们创建了这个数据库。不过因为我们目前还没有创建任何数据表,所以可以看到 `think_bbs` 这个数据库的表是空的。
![Connect Testing](http://tbs.zhanghong.info/images/chapters/02/070_test_conn_db.png)
- 第一章 基础信息
- 序言
- 关于作者
- PHP和ThinkPHP
- 如何正确阅读本书
- 写作约定
- 开发规范
- 章节体例
- 本书源码
- 第二章 舞台布置
- 开发环境
- 产品分解
- Git和GitHub
- 创建项目
- 数据库视图管理工具
- 统一代码风格
- 目录结构
- 配置信息
- 后台应用搭建
- 助手函数
- 前台布局模板
- 基础控制器
- 小结
- 第三章 注册登录
- 数据迁移
- 表单提交
- 表单验证
- 模型验证
- 短信提供商
- 发送短信
- 手机验证
- 注册提醒
- 登录与退出
- 重置密码
- 数据填充
- 小结
- 第四章 用户相关
- 个人中心
- 编辑个人资料
- 上传图片
- 上传头像
- 显示头像
- 限制头像分辨率
- 裁剪头像
- 显示注册时间
- 授权访问
- 小结
- 第五章 帖子列表
- 话题分类
- 话题模型
- 话题列表
- 性能优化
- 分类话题列表
- 话题列表排序
- 用户发布的话题
- 分页器美化
- 小结
- 第六章_帖子CURD
- 创建话题
- 生成摘要
- 编辑器优化
- 上传图片
- 显示话题
- 编辑话题
- 删除话题
- 小结
- 第七章 帖子回复
- 回复模型
- 回复列表
- 发表回复
- 删除回复
- XSS 安全漏洞
- 小结
- 第八章 角色权限和管理后台
- 多角色用户权限
- 用户管理
- 话题管理
- 回复管理
- 小结
- 第九章 杂项
- 边栏活跃用户
- 用户最后登录时间
- 边栏资源推荐
- 站点首页
- 小结
- 第十章 总结
- 全书总结
- 附录
- 浅谈ThinkPHP6.0 路由